The Rise of Social Gaming: Data-Driven Insights

Recent industry reports reveal that the global social gaming market was valued at approximately USD 30 billion in 2022, with projections estimating a compounded ann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10% through 2027. Key drivers include increased smartphone penetration, the proliferation of free-to-play models, and the integration of social features that foster community building.

Global Social Gaming Market Overview (2022-2027)
Year Market Value (USD Billion) Growth Rate
2022 30
2023 33 10%
2024 36.3 10%
2025 39.9 10%
2026 43.9 10.02%

Quality Engagement: The Role of Free-to-Play Models

Central to the widespread adoption of social gaming is the play for free paradigm. This approach lowers entry barriers, inviting users into immersive experiences without upfront costs. The free-to-play (F2P) model, combined with in-game purchases and ad-based monetisation, has redefined revenue streams within the industry.

“F2P has become the backbone of social gaming, catalysing user acquisition and retention through monetisation that aligns with user preferences and behaviour.” – Industry Analysis 2023

Platforms like Fortnite and Genshin Impact exemplify how high-quality content delivered on a free-to-play basis can attract millions, with monetisation carried out through cosmetic upgrades and premium content. This strategic model underscores the importance of balancing user experience with effective monetisation, a nuanced expertise that distinguishes successful social gaming operations.

Cultivating Community and Social Dynamics

Beyond the mechanics of gameplay, social connectivity remains a key driver. Features such as chat functions, multiplayer competitions, and collaborative events foster a sense of community, crucial for user retention.

Research indicates that social interactions within gaming platforms can enhance user lifetime value (LTV) by fostering emotional investment. Platforms that effectively harness social features—like leaderboards or virtual item trading—experience higher engagement rates, which directly influence revenue streams.
